Winfred Vernon Griffin, Jr., better known as Vernon Griffin of Bussey, Arkansas, passed on Monday, March 1, 2021. He was born in Magnolia, AR on February 4,1953 to Winfred Vernon Griffin, Sr. and Marie Robertson Griffin. He was preceded in death by both parents, his oldest brother, James Griffin and sister, Mary Ellen Culp.
Vernon is survived by his wife of 24 years, Krista Henry Griffin of Stamps; two sons, Troy V. Griffin and wife Ashley and Kyle V. Griffin; two daughters, Staci Griffin Wilson and husband Chris and Natalie Griffin Holland and husband Nick; two step sons, Darren Phillips and Dillon Phillips and wife Brittany; 10 grandchildren, Colton Griffin, Levi Griffin, Wyatt Wilson, Emmaline Holland, Lydia Holland, Skylar Phillips, Kristin Cole Phillips, Liam Phillips, Marley Phillips and one on the way, Romy Phillips; One Brother Dr. Rodney Griffin and wife Rosemary and many other nieces, nephews and loved ones.
Vernon loved to spend time outdoors. He enjoyed hunting, fishing, gardening and his tractor. He had a soft place in his heart for the animal kind and kept many pets throughout the years including dogs,cats, birds, squirrels, a raccoon and two bobcats. Vernon was a pharmacist by profession and owned Griffins Pharmacy in Stamps, AR. He was in pharmacy for about 42 years. He retired in 2019, hoping to finally spend more time doing all of those things that he enjoyed but was stricken with a debilitating illness that gradually took all of his mobility and eventually his life.
